Earlier I mentioned the state of CDs in our household. Today while attempting to re-rip Shania Twain - Greatest Hits (one of Linda’s CDs) the SuperDrive in my PowerBook stopped loading media. I would put a CD or DVD into the drive, and after a couple of seconds of whurring the disk would eject. It didn’t matter what type of disk was inserted (audio CD, brand new blank, freshly unwrapped DVD), it was quickly ejected.
A quick search on the Apple Discussion Forums led me to this knowledge base article describing trouble shooting procedures for slot loading drives. After following it’s directions (resetting the PMU), I am happy to say that the drive is now funtioning.
